Covestro MAKROFOL® LM 228 2-4 160005 Polycarbonate Films
Categories: Polymer; Film; Thermoplastic; Polycarbonate (PC)

Material Notes: Characterization: Makrofol LM 228 2-4 160005 is an extruded polycarbonate film.

Properties / Applications: Makrofol LM 228 2-4 160005 is an extruded polycarbonate film filled with light-scattering agent. It displays a smooth homogenous illumination of the front side of a backlight part even if a point source is applied. Typical applications are automotive instrument panels and backlight displays. Makrofol LM 228 2-4 160005 is available in standard thicknesses of 0.012" and 0.020" (300 microns and 500 microns). The surface structure of Makrofol LM 228 2-4 160005 is one side very fine matte and one side fine matte. As with any product, use of Makrofol LM 228 2-4 160005 in a given application must be tested (including but not limited to field testing) in advance by the user to determine suitability.

Physical PropertiesOriginal ValueComments
Specific Gravity 1.20 g/ccISO 1183, Method C
Water Absorption 0.20 %following ISO 62
 
Mechanical PropertiesOriginal ValueComments
Film Elongation at Break, MD >= 105 %ISO 527-1,-3
Film Elongation at Break, TD >= 100 %ISO 527-1,-3
Tensile Modulus >= 1800 MPaTD; ISO 527-1,-3
 >= 1850 MPaMD; ISO 527-1,-3
Film Tensile Strength at Break, MD >= 50.0 MPaISO 527-1,-3
Film Tensile Strength at Break, TD >= 50.0 MPaISO 527-1,-3
 
Electrical PropertiesOriginal ValueComments
Surface Resistance 1.00e+16 ohmfollowing DIN IEC 60093
 
Optical PropertiesOriginal ValueComments
Haze 100 %
@Wavelength 300 nm
back surface; ASTM D 1003
 100 %
@Wavelength 300 nm
top surface; ASTM D 1003
 100 %
@Wavelength 500 nm
back surface; ASTM D 1003
 100 %
@Wavelength 500 nm
top surface; ASTM D 1003
Gloss <= 60 %60°, back surface; ISO 2813
 >= 80 %60°, top surface; ISO 2813
Transmission, Visible 65 %
@Wavelength 500 nm
back surface; ISO 13467-2
 65 %
@Wavelength 500 nm
top surface; ISO 13467-2
UV Transmittance 72 %
@Wavelength 300 nm
top surface; ISO 13467-2
 73 %
@Wavelength 300 nm
back surface; ISO 13467-2
